Abstract
A new intermediate parent 'Wonye 30002' (Allium cepa L.) was developed by Bioenergy Crop Research Center, NICS in 2009. As a male sterile line, 'Wonye 30002' can be used to hybrid seed production by crossing with pollen parent. The first cross was conducted between male sterile plants of 402AC203 and M1 in 2002. The male sterile line 'Wonye 30002' has circular bulb and bulb weight is 283 g. As early maturing type, lodging date is May 6. Plant height and pseudostem diameter are 43 cm and 15.5 mm, respectively. In seed harvesting characteristics, number of flower stalks and the length are 43 cm and 110 cm, respectively. The flowering date of 'Wonye 30002' is around May 24 and is completely male sterile. 'Wonye 30002' is a promising male sterile line for hybrid bulb onion seed production.
